#b7ed93 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7ed93 is composed of 71.8% red, 92.9%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 38%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 75.3%. #b7ed93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6fdb27.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#b7ed93

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a02 is the darkest color, while #fafef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7ed93

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0c1bf is the less saturated color, while #b4fc84 is the most saturated one.
